According to the official Monopoly rules: 'Whenever a player arrive on an unowned residential or commercial property he may purchase that residential or commercial property from the Bank at its printed price [...] If he does not want to buy the residential or commercial property it is sold at auction by the Banker to the highest bidder.'

Monopoly fans were dealt with to a variety of genius methods in 2015, when cash saving specialist Martin Lewis shared his creative tricks for winning the video game.

Sharing the strategies on his ITV show, Martin Lewis: How to Win at Board Games, the cash saving expert discussed that there are several things you can do to beat other gamers and improve your odds.

His first pointer is to buy as lots of residential or commercial properties as possible during the early stages of the game.

Martin stated that it was likewise important to compute the return on financial investment on each residential or commercial property, indicating how much you acquired it for versus just how much you can make back from lease.

However, not all residential or commercial properties are produced equivalent. Although the most pricey ones begin being the finest investment, this modifications when houses and hotels are included.

Those wishing to win ought to aim to buy the 3 light blue cards which are The Angel, Islington, Euston Road and Pentonville Road, as these can create the most cash as soon as hotels are contributed to them.

After that, he suggests stroking up the orange cards comprising of Vine Street, Marlborough Street, and Bow Street.

Martin highlighted that these are the residential or commercial properties that gamers are more than likely to arrive on after they've just gotten out of jail.

The worst set to buy in his viewpoint are the pricey greens - including Bond Street, Oxford Street, and Regent Street.

Therefore, Martin shared, it is important to purchase one of each colour, so you can obstruct challengers and have some take advantage of when it concerns doing offers later on down the line.

Martin included that if you have cards that are not part of a set, you need to mortgage them to the bank for additional money to buy houses, considering that they're not likely to create much income for you.
